Evelyn L Rask 1910 - 1977

Evelyn L Rask was born on February 24, 1910, and died at age 67 years old on June 12, 1977. Evelyn Rask was buried at Riverside National Cemetery Section 8 Site 803A 22495 Van Buren Boulevard, in Riverside, Ca.
